When To Replace Your San Diego Blinds

Here are some things to keep in mind that may mean it’s time for a blind replacement.

You’ve Recently Installed New Windows

After a window replacement, you may find that your old blinds just don’t fit right. There might be less depth, making them difficult to reinstall. Or maybe they just don’t look right with the new windows. This is a good time to look into some new San Diego blinds.

Your Blinds Are Out Of Style

San Diego BlindsIf you still have blinds from when your home was built, or were there before you moved in, they are likely out of style. Old window coverings have a way of making your whole home appear dated. Not only that but if they’re old enough to be out of style, they are also likely worn out.

Generally speaking, blinds have a life of about 7 to 8 years.

They Fail To Meet Your Needs

Sub par blinds often fail to give you an adequate level of privacy. They also do nothing to help save you energy. Good San Diego blinds will achieve two things at once:

  • Give you privacy and lighting control
  • Save you energy by helping keep your home cool during the summer and warm during the winter

Even if you like the appearance of your select blinds and think they’re in great shape, they can fail to carry about these functions properly. When it comes to window coverings, you want the kind of product that will both maximize your living space and keep your energy costs low.

The Slats Don’t Close Tightly Enough

San Diego BlindsThis can be a problem that develops over time. When blinds get old and worn out, it can become more and more difficult to close them up all the way. Often this is the result of an old tilt wand mechanism, which is almost impossible to replace without having to re-cord the entire blind.

Deciding to select blinds that are higher in quality is both easier and more beneficial in the long-term.

They’re Yellowed or Discolored

Blinds are ultimately here to block light, and the harsh UV light from the sun will have an effect on blinds over a long enough period of time. UV light creates a yellowed or otherwise discolored look to your blinds, giving your home an old, unkempt appearance. This is also a sign that the material itself has deteriorated.

When this happens, it’s time to swap them out for some high quality San Diego blinds that provide more UV protection.

The Cords Are Frayed

If the cords on your blinds have become frayed, it’s probably time for a replacement. Blinds with frayed cords are likely old and will fail to meet your requirements in other areas as well. There may also be internal mechanisms that are causing damage to the cord as well.

Whatever the case may be, blinds with frayed cords need to be replaced soon, as they are likely to become unstable and fall.

They Are Difficult To Raise

If your blinds have become difficult or even impossible to raise, there is likely one of two things going on. Either your lifting mechanism is damaged or broken, or your blinds were made too wide, and the lifting mechanism just can’t support their weight.

Blinds that are difficult to lift are likely on the verge of falling with the right amount of force. It’s best to replace them entirely. With Vineyard Blind and Shutter, you can select blinds that are easy to raise and lower.
